The Polson Banner is among the oldest interschool rugby prizes available in New Zealand, pitting Palmerston North Boys' High School and Napier Boys' High School against one another in 1st XV action every year.
The archrivals have contested the Polson Banner annually since 1904. The original silk banner was donated by the 1902-12 NBHS headmaster, A.S. Polson, and has the colours and the crest of the two respective schools on the reverse sides. The scores for each year's match has been embroidered on the banner over the years.
The ledger stands 64-46 in Palmerston North BHS’s favour, with six matches drawn. Napier BHS won the 2017-18 clashes but their bid for a Polson Banner hat-trick was denied last year by PNBHS in a gripping, see-sawing encounter, which also saw crucial Super 8 points up for grabs.
